Clearance Concerns For Fifth Wheel Trailer With 2015 Ford F-350 With Tow Package  

Question:

I need a good hitch at a decent price for my ford f350 with the prep package. Is this a good hitch and will I be able to tell if the jaws are locked in. My fifth wheel is 12000lbs. I was going to buy the adapter and use my existing hitch but from the ground to the top of the tailgate when opened is 41.5 inches and when my fifthwheel is level from ground to the kingpin is 54.5 inches I dont think it will work

0

Expert Reply:

The height of the sides of the bed on your 2015 Ford F-350 is a critical measurement you will want to know. since you said the height of the bed when the tail gate is down is 41.5 inches, and the height of your fifth wheel trailer king pin is 54.5 inches, that will only give you 13 inches from the bed to the king pin.

The weight of the fifth wheel trailer when it is hooked up will cause the back of the truck to drop a bit and the amount will depend on the weight.

I spoke with my contact at Curt and they told me that the part # C16515-16017, you referenced has a height adjustment from 13 to 17 inches, They said they have not have any complaints about the Ford bed sides being too tall or interfering with installation of a fifth wheel setup.

You need a minimum of 6 inches clearance from the top of the bed sides to the bottom of the trailer. Many fifth wheel pin boxes are adjustable as well, so you may be able to gain additional clearance there.
